Strength of Compassion

by Nessa Eledhwen

(page 1)

"Through Compassion we gain Unity...

through Unity we gain Strength...

Evil lacks unity and, thus, strength."

(page 2-3)

-What is Compassion?

Some say we all have a sense of compassion toward our fellow kin.  Often times, our keenness to this sense determines how "good or evil" someone is.  Compassion is shown through the selfless aid of others.  When our kin are in need of help, it is our duty to assist.  Through these selfless acts one can show their compassion.

(page 4-5)

-Compassion and Unity

When one does a good deed for another, often times, expected or not, they are rewarded.  But above all tangible goods is another, priceless reward...trust.  By doing good deeds for another, one gains trust.  By gaining their trust, they can gain their aid.  Helping each other and creating bonds is what unity is about.

(page 6-7)

-Unity and Strength

There are times when a task is too great for one person alone.  Through unity, we gain the ability to work together toward a common goal.  Combining the strength of the many creates a strength surpassing any other.  Through unity, we create the bonds to help each other through the impossible.

(page 8-9)

-Evil and Compassion

Evil lacks compassion.  When they need something done, they rely on their own strength.  They ignore their sense of compassion and refuse to aid others in need.  Without the aid of others, they must rely on their own strength, and, therefor, their own limits.

(page 10-11)

-Evil and Unity

Evil lacks the compassion to build trust.  Their self-centered ways often lead to turmoil within their own ranks.  Power-hungry minions will kill their own lords for a chance at power.  Without trust, evil leads itself down a perilous path of self-destruction.

(page 12-13)

-Evil and Strength

There will always be tasks too difficult for one alone...Evil refuses to admit this.  They believe they can increase their own strength until they are gods.  It is impossible. All are bound by their own limits.  Evil's strength is limited to these boundaries.

(page 14-15)

-Evil and Weakness

Evil lacks compassion...a lack of compassion means a lack of strength, and, thus, weakness.  The compassionate are able to boost one another to endless possibilities.  Through compassion and unity, good has strength far greater than evil, and can overcome it.

(page 16)

Compassion...

Unity...

Strength...

(page 17)

That is the true strength of compassion.

                                                                  Nessa Eledhwen

(the end)
